Georgian Court University vs. City Tech Cost Comparison

Which college is more expensive, Georgian Court University or City Tech?

  • Georgian Court University is 410.2% more expensive to attend than City Tech for in-state tuition ($35,360.00 vs. $6,930.00)
  • Out of state tuition is 137.6% higher at Georgian Court University than CUNY New York City College of Technology ($35,360.00 vs. $14,880.00)
  • The typical actual cost that students pay to attend (average net price) is less at CUNY New York City College of Technology than Georgian Court University ($5,417 vs. $21,072)
  • Living costs (room and board or off-campus housing budget) at Georgian Court University are 68.8% lower than costs at CUNY New York City College of Technology ($12,910 vs. $21,788)
  • More students receive financial grant aid at Georgian Court University than CUNY New York City College of Technology (99% vs. 86%)
  • The average total grant financial aid received by Georgian Court University students is 250.3% larger than aid received CUNY New York City College of Technology ($27,689 vs. $7,904)

Georgian Court University vs. City Tech Graduation Outcomes Comparison

Which is better, Georgian Court University or City Tech? Graduation rate, salary and amount of student loan debt are indicators of a college which offers better outcomes for its graduates. Compare the following outcomes facts between City Tech and Georgian Court University.

  • The graduation rate at Georgian Court University is higher than CUNY New York City College of Technology (52% vs. 24%)
  • Graduates from CUNY New York City College of Technology earn on average $1,000 more per year than Georgian Court University graduates after ten years. ($43,000 vs. $42,000)
  • CUNY New York City College of Technology students graduate with a $14,387 lower median federal student loan debt than Georgian Court University graduates. ($10,613 vs. $25,000)
  • City Tech graduates are paying $149 less per month on federal student loans than Georgian Court University graduates. ($109 vs. $258)
  • More Georgian Court University graduates are actively paying back their federal student loan debt than former City Tech students, three years after graduation. (56% vs. 47%)
